Gritting and grit bins
The Council is gritting roads. Gritting is not a magic solution though. It can be washed away by rain and covered up by snow. Gritting works best on busy roads – the tyres of cars and lorries grinds the snow into the salt grit, making it melt more quickly.
The council will grit main routes first.
If there is time and resource the Council also grits the secondary routes. Most residential roads will not be gritted.
There are nine grit bins in Cheadle & Gatley – six of them on the Lakes estate. These are on steep residential roads or paths and should be kept topped-up by the council. The grit is for use on public roads and footpaths, not on private driveways!
